On 1/7/21 at 11:45am, Licensing Program Analyst (LPA) Briana Plumboy met with licensee Rosario Guzman for an unannounced Case Management inspection which was initiated by the licensee. This facility was on inactive status effective 06/09/21 and would like to be placed back on active status. The facility currently operates from 6:00am until 6:00pm, and per licensee, she is flexible with the families. Families enter licensees home through the side gate.

The home is single story. The home has heating and ventilation for safety and comfort. The ON LIMIT AREAS are the hallway bathroom, living room, and enclosed day care room. The OFF LIMIT AREAS are the 3 bedrooms, family room, master bathroom, kitchen/dining room, and garage which will be inaccessible by closed and/or locked doors and visual supervision. The ISOLATION AREA will be an area located inside the day care room. The BACKYARD play area is fenced for for children's use. There are toys and learning materials. All hazardous materials and toxins are kept out of the reach of children and it was observed that there are no toxins or hazardous items accessible during today's inspection. LPA Plumboy discussed the importance of keeping hazardous items out of the reach of children. Licensee has a current CPR and First Aid certificate which expires 09/18/22. The facility has a working smoke detector, working carbon monoxide detector, and 3A40BC fire extinguisher. The licensee's mandated reporter training is complete and she received a certification of completion on 01/01/24.

The facility is placed back on active status. No deficiencies cited during today's inspection. An exit interview was conducted. This report shall remain on file for 3 years. A notice of site visit was given and must remain posted for 30 days. Exit interview conducted applicant.
